- [ ] **Step 4 — Provision the Scanmere barcode integration key.** During the quarterly key ceremony, generate the new signing key used by the Scanmere scanner gateway to authenticate device enrollments. Verify that both ceremony witnesses from the Harbrook ops rotation are present and have initialed the log before proceeding. Once the key is generated, it must be sealed into the offline hardware module immediately; do not leave it on the ceremony laptop. Sealing the module prompts for the recovery passphrase below.

strongbox words: zorwyn-sorael-belion-ulaius-silmir-ulays-briax-rusdor-gorix

// REINDEX_BATCH_CAP limits docs per shard pass in the Tallowfield
// nightly search reindex. Raising it starves the ingest queue;
// lowering it overruns the maintenance window. 5000 is the tested
// sweet spot. Change only with a soak run. Verified against the
// build noted below.

session token of bawif-hahog = htk6_ac5981

Internal Memo — Closure of the Farrowgate Office

Finance team: the Farrowgate satellite office closes at the end of next month. Lease termination fees are within budget; remaining furniture transfers to the Ashden site. Three staff relocate, two positions end with severance per policy. Book all closure costs to the restructuring line. Hallie Drummond coordinates. Details of the broader plan follow below.

confidential, tagag-kahof: Rusathox Partners plans to lower the Gorox list price by 63 percent in December.